The postcard is dated 14th April 1917 and signed 'With best wishes
240478 Corporal A Fleming, 4th The King's Own Royal Lancaster Regiment,
Park Hall Camp, Oswestry. The interior view shows four soldiers
sitting or lying on beds and one standing near the door. Two trunks can
been seen, on which has written on ‘J.R. Smith Regimental Tailor 5th
King’s Own Royal Lancaster Regiment, Row Head, Lancaster’. The other has
‘J Parkinson The King’s Own’.
The photograph probably dates from the time that the 4th and 5th Reserve
battalions were merged into one.
Accession Number: KO2546/76

Detail of KO2546/76.

Items pinned to the wall of the hut include a copy of the 'Fleetwood
Chronicle' which again suggest 5th Battalion personnel.
